1971 Omega Genève Automatic — Tonneau Sport-Luxury
This 1971 Omega Genève Automatic (Ref. 166.099) presents the tonneau-shaped stainless steel case and integrated bracelet silhouette typical of early 1970s sport-luxury design. The watch is fitted with an acrylic crystal and its original Omega stainless-steel bracelet (Ref. 366.822), preserving the era’s intended proportions. Power comes from the Caliber 1481, an automatic movement offering a quick-set date (The quick-set date function is not working, but this does not affect the standard date alignment. The date indicator can still be adjusted manually in the traditional way). For a modern enthusiast, this Genève balances period character and wearable dimensions, offering clear mechanical interest and authentic 1970s styling.
